Goat Dairy Products Market Size, Share, Trends, and Forecast 2025–2035
The global goat dairy products market size is estimated at USD 96.95 billion in 2025 and is expected to reach USD 182.78 billion by 2034, growing at a CAGR of 7.3% during the forecast period. This growth is primarily fueled by the rising consumer demand for functional foods and dairy alternatives worldwide.
Goat Dairy Products Market Overview
Goat dairy products include milk, yogurt, cheese, butter, ice cream, ghee, infant formula, and whey protein derived from goat milk. These products are associated with strong digestion benefits, anti-inflammatory proteins, and rich micronutrient profiles. The category is especially popular among health-conscious consumers, people with cow milk intolerance, and families looking for natural nutritional alternatives.
Growing penetration of goat dairy in premium retail channels, urban markets, and e-commerce has added momentum to market expansion. Brands are also innovating with flavored, organic, grass-fed, and probiotic-enhanced product lines to attract wider audiences.

Why Goat Dairy is Becoming a Consumer Favourite
Modern consumers especially millennials and Gen Z are redefining dietary norms with mindful choices. Goat dairy aligns with many of today’s top wellness priorities:
- Easier Digestion
Goat milk contains smaller fat globules and lower lactose compared to cow’s milk. The presence of A2 casein proteins also results in reduced inflammation and makes it a gentler option for those with milk sensitivities.
- High Nutrient Density
- Goat dairy is naturally rich in:
- Protein and essential amino acids
- Vitamin A, Vitamin D, and B-complex vitamins
- Calcium, iron, magnesium, and selenium
These nutrients support bone strength, immune function, and overall metabolic health.

Different Products Made From Goat Milk
The goat dairy industry has evolved far beyond traditional fresh milk, offering a wide variety of products that cater to everyday consumption as well as specialized nutrition. Some of the most popular categories include:
- Goat Milk: Available in fresh, UHT, powdered, and flavored versions.
- Goat Cheese: From soft chèvre spreads and feta to aged hard cheese and mozzarella, widely used in culinary applications.
- Goat Yogurt & Greek Yogurt: Often enriched with probiotics and available in natural and flavored choices.
- Goat Butter & Ghee: Preferred for rich flavor and clean fatty acid profile.
- Goat Ice Cream & Gelato: A lactose-friendly dessert alternative gaining steam in premium frozen aisles.
- Goat Milk Infant Formula: A fast-growing segment as parents seek gentle and nutritionally dense formulas for babies.
- Goat Whey Protein: Becoming a popular choice in sports and medical nutrition because of superior absorption.

Goat Dairy Products Market Regional Analysis
The global goat dairy products market shows significant regional variation, with each area exhibiting unique drivers, consumer behaviors, and growth opportunities.
- Europe
Europe remains the largest market for goat dairy products, thanks to its long history of goat farming, well-established dairy infrastructure, and strong culinary traditions involving goat milk cheeses and yogurts. Countries like France, Spain, the Netherlands, and Italy are key contributors, with artisanal and premium cheeses playing a central role in both domestic consumption and exports. Consumers in Europe are increasingly health-conscious and favor organic, grass-fed, and probiotic-enriched products, supporting the growth of value-added goat dairy segments. In addition, strong government regulations and certifications on organic and sustainable dairy farming help reinforce consumer trust.
- Asia-Pacific
Asia-Pacific is witnessing the fastest growth in the goat dairy market. Rapid urbanization, rising disposable incomes, and growing awareness about digestive health and functional nutrition are driving consumer adoption. Goat milk is increasingly used in infant formula, toddler nutrition, and fortified yogurts, particularly in countries like China, India, and Japan. The expansion of modern retail and e-commerce platforms has made goat dairy products more accessible, while premiumization trends are encouraging local and international brands to launch new offerings tailored to health-conscious and urban consumers.
- North America
North America maintains steady market momentum, primarily driven by consumer interest in clean-label, organic, and specialty dairy products. Health-conscious millennials and Gen Z consumers are seeking alternatives to cow milk, including goat milk products that offer easier digestibility and functional benefits. The United States and Canada are seeing growth in artisanal cheeses, flavored goat yogurts, and goat milk-based infant formula, while e-commerce and subscription-based deliveries are making these products more convenient for urban populations.
- Middle East and Africa
The Middle East and Africa present high growth potential, supported by longstanding cultural consumption of goat milk, which has traditionally been a staple in many local diets. Goats are well-suited to the arid and semi-arid climates of the region, making goat farming a sustainable and economically viable option. Increased awareness of health benefits, combined with the modernization of dairy processing infrastructure, is encouraging value-added product launches such as packaged milk, cheese, and yogurt. Countries like Saudi Arabia, UAE, Egypt, and South Africa are emerging as key markets.
- Latin America
Latin America is experiencing gradual market expansion, fueled by government initiatives promoting sustainable livestock development and support for local dairy brands. Countries such as Brazil, Argentina, and Mexico are adopting modern goat farming techniques to improve yield and product quality. The rising middle class and urban consumers are showing greater interest in premium, organic, and functional goat dairy products, creating opportunities for both domestic and international players to expand their presence in the region.
